the code, the same as your browser does. The Requests library can’t do this to suit your needs, but you'll find other methods that will:
The Requests library is utilized to ship HTTP requests to a web site and retrieve the HTML content with the Online page. You’ll require to get the raw HTML prior to deciding to can parse and method it with Beautiful Soup.
Copied! It can be hard to wrap your head close to a long block of HTML code. To really make it much easier to go through, You should use an HTML formatter to clean up the HTML automatically.
Using the .father or mother attribute that every BeautifulSoup object includes will give you an intuitive technique to step by way of your DOM framework and address The weather you need. You may as well access boy or girl aspects and sibling things in a similar way. Browse up on navigating the tree To find out more.
You may scrape any web-site on the web which you can evaluate, but the difficulty of doing so depends on the positioning. This tutorial gives you an introduction to World wide web scraping that will help you understand the overall course of action. Then, you'll be able to use this exact same approach For each Web site that you would like to scrape.
For those who print the .textual content attribute of web page, You Web Scraping then’ll see that it appears to be much like the HTML you inspected before along with your browser’s developer tools.
These browser controls also parse Websites right into a DOM tree, according to which courses can retrieve areas of the internet pages. Languages including Xpath can be employed to parse the ensuing DOM tree.
In lots of jobs, you first “crawl” the net or one particular distinct Web-site to find out URLs which then you pass on in your scraper.
Even though they commonly tend not to include a subscription tag, and are possibly freely accessible or for a just one-time license fee, In addition they call for you to maintain any scraper scenarios you will be operating.
Because of this, specialised instruments and computer software have been formulated to facilitate the scraping of Web content. World wide web scraping applications include things like sector investigation, cost comparison, information monitoring, and much more. Businesses depend upon web scraping expert services to successfully Collect and benefit from this info.
The good news is always that alterations to Sites will often be modest and incremental, therefore you’ll possible be capable to update your scraper with small changes.
Observe job listings across a number of platforms to locate new alternatives and acquire insights into selecting tendencies.
If you use an API, the info assortment procedure is usually much more stable than it is thru World wide web scraping. That’s mainly because developers produce APIs to become eaten by programs rather than by human eyes.
Net scraping, World-wide-web harvesting, or Internet facts extraction is data scraping utilized for extracting facts from Web sites.[1] World-wide-web scraping software program could instantly access the World Wide Web using the Hypertext Transfer Protocol or an internet browser.